Zeekr will debut the flagship 9X SUV at the 2025 Shanghai Auto Show

Geely’s premium electric vehicle brand, Zeekr, is set to debut its new flagship 9X SUV at the 2025 Shanghai Auto Show. Positioning the model as Zeekr’s most advanced offering in the full-size luxury EV segment, the vehicle will be available in pure electric (BEV) and plug-in hybrid (PHEV) variants featuring the new Zeekr Super Hybrid system.

The BEV version will feature a cutting-edge 900V high-voltage architecture capable of ultra-fast charging up to 480kW. Utilizing CATL’s latest battery technology, the system is expected to add approximately 500 km of range in just 10 minutes of charging. The PHEV variant will debut Zeekr’s Super Hybrid technology, combining a high-efficiency 2.0T engine with multiple electric motors in an advanced powertrain that intelligently switches between pure electric, series hybrid and parallel hybrid modes. This system targets a total range of approximately 1,500 km on a full charge and tank of fuel.

The Zeekr 9X is expected to share similarities with the Lynk & Co 900. Its dimensions, measuring 5,290 mm in length and a 3,220 mm wheelbase, the 9X will offer versatile interior configurations. Standard models will accommodate six or seven passengers with sliding and reclining seat functionality, while the premium edition will feature a luxurious four-seat layout with executive-style rear seating. Practical touches include a split tailgate design with an integrated seating platform for outdoor use.

The 9X will showcase Zeekr’s next-generation autonomous driving capabilities, powered by NVIDIA’s new Thor chipset. The advanced system will incorporate camera and LiDAR sensors to enable potential Level 3 driving functions, including urban navigation without reliance on high-definition maps, automated valet parking, and enhanced highway assistance features.

As Zeekr’s new flagship, the 9X will join the brand’s growing luxury portfolio alongside the 009 MPV. Production is expected to begin following its official debut in Shanghai, with final specifications and pricing to be confirmed at the unveiling.
